16thNovember - Southern Negev
We decided to check some military areas in
this morning with the hope of finding some sandgrouse at their
favourite drinking pool. Sure enough, just after 8am we heard
the 'cackling' calls of Crowned Sandgrouse and 11 birds flew
by and landed in the desert giving extremely good, prolonged
views. About half an hour later large numbers of Spotted Sandgrouse
began to arrive with about 110 birds coming into drink giving
a thrilling spectacle.
Good views of other species in the area included Bluethroat,
Mourning Wheatear, Water Pipit
and 2 Desert Finch that came in to drink.

We spent much of the afternoon in the area
of Eilat but found migrants in rather short supply. However,
the afternoon was lifted by superb views of 24 Lichtenstein's
Sandgrouse drinking at a traditional spot towards
dusk, bringing our sandgrouse tally for the day to three species
and we were certainly pleased with that.
